Comprehending Mesothelioma and Its Causes
Mesothelioma is a malignant tumor that establishes in the mesothelium, the protective lining covering the lungs, abdominal area, and heart. The main cause of mesothelioma is direct exposure to asbestos, a naturally taking place mineral as soon as extensively utilized in building, insulation, and various commercial applications. Other possible causes include genetic factors and direct exposure to radiation or other carcinogenic products; however, asbestos direct exposure stays the most widespread.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)What is the timeline for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
The timeline can vary widely depending on the complexity of the case and the jurisdiction in which the case is filed. Cases can take months or years to resolve, but lots of settled cases might finish within a year.
Just how much payment can a mesothelioma victim anticipate?
Compensation amounts differ substantially based upon factors like the seriousness of the health problem, the business accountable for asbestos exposure, and the jurisdiction. Settlements can vary from thousands to countless dollars.
Can I submit a claim if I was exposed to asbestos indirectly?
Yes, people who were indirectly exposed, such as family members of workers who brought home asbestos fibers, might have legal option.
What if the business accountable is no longer in organization?
If the accountable company has actually stated insolvency, victims may have the alternative of filing claims with asbestos trust funds developed to compensate victims.
Do I require to go to court for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Not all cases need a trial. Lots of Mesothelioma Lawsuit Information cases are settled out of court, however some might continue to trial if a reasonable settlement can not be reached.
